We have a fantastic opportunity for a motivated and experienced healthcare professional to join our Epworth team as Business Development Manager based at Epworth Rehabilitation. Reporting to the Group Director, Strategic Business Development, this role will be responsible for managing and implementing Business Development activities in-line with the strategic and operational plans for Epworth Rehabilitation.
You will work closely with the Epworth Rehabilitation Executive and Leadership team and collaborate with the broader Business Development team across the Epworth group to deliver targeted growth of key clinical services. As Business Development Manager you will identify new and liaise with existing medical specialists and support the development of their private practice.
You will be supported in learning the tasks of the role and work as a member of a very supportive team. It is essential you understanding the private hospital industry, have experience working with medical specialists and have confidence and self-drive to achieve agreed KPIs.

About Rehabilitation & Mental Health
Epworth Rehabilitation and Mental Health services are some of the most progressive of their kind in Australia. Our clinical approach involves individualised treatment and collaborative team decision-making to achieve positive outcomes for patients. Our strong team ethos extends across our rehabilitation and mental health services at our Epworth hospitals in Richmond, Camberwell, Hawthorn and Geelong.
